Technical Information
Microprocessor
The
803868X
is
a high-performancemicroprocessor
with
a
16-bit
external data path,
up to 16
megabytes
of
directly
addressable
physical memory
and
up to 64
terabytes
of
virtual memory
space.
The
operating
speed
of
the 803868X
chip
is
10MHz
in
Normal
mode
and
20MHz
in
Turbo
mode.
The
803868X operates
in
two
modes: protected
vir-
tual
address
mode
and
real
address
mode.
Protected
Virtual
Address
Mode
In
protected
mode,
softwarecan
perform
a task
switch
to
enter
virtual
8086 mode tasks.
Each
task behaves
with
8086 semantics, thus
allowing
8086 software
(an
application
program
or
an
entire
operation system)
to
execute.
The virtual
8086 tasks can be isolated and
protected
from
one another and the host 386SX
microprocessoroperation system
by
use
of
paging.
Protected
mode
will
use one
of
two different
address
spaces,
depending
on
whether
or not
paging
is
enabled.
Every
selector has a
logical
base address
of
up to 32 bits
in
length. This 32-bit logical
base address
is
added
to
the
effective
address
to form
a
final 32-bit
linear
address.
if
paging
is
disabled,
this final linear
address
reflects physical memory
and
is
truncated so
that
only
the
lower 24 bits of this
address are used
to
address the
16
megabyte
memory
address space.
If
paging
is
enabled
this final linear
address
reflects
a
32-bit
address.
This
is
translated
through
the
paging
unit to form
a 16-megabyte
physical
address.
32
j
)
)
Real
Address
Mode
Syst
in
real mode
the 3868X microprocessor operates
as
a
very fast 8086, but with
a
32-bit
extension
if
desired.
Real mode
is
required primarily to
set
up
the proces-
sor
for
protected
mode
operation.
The
segmentation
unit shifts
the selector
left
four bits
and adds the
result to
the
effective
address
to form
the
linear
address.
This linear
address
is_
limited to
1
megabyte.
In
addition, real
mode has
no
paging
capability.
em Timers
The
system has three programmable timer/counters
controlled by
the
Intel
8254-2 chip.
These are chan-
nels
0
through
2
defined
as
follows:
Channel
0
System
Timer
GATE
0
TlED ON
CLK
IN
0
1.190MHz
OSC
CLK
OUT
0
8259A lRO 0
Channel
1
Refresh
Request Generator
GATE
1
TlED ON
CLK
IN
1
1.190MHz
OSC
CLK
OUT
1
Request Refresh
Cycle
NOTE:
Channel
1
is
programmed
to
generate a
15
microsecond
signal.
Channel
2
Tone
Generation
for
Speaker
GATE 2
Controlled
by bit 0 of port hex
61
PP1 bit
CLK
IN
2
1.190MHz
OSC
CLK OUT 2
Used
to
drive speaker
33
Summary of Contents for Mini 80386SX
Page 1: ...o Mini 803863X 20MHz Mainboard User s Manual ...
Page 26: ......